Man accused in KPT woman’s 2019 murder accepts plea deal

Summary by WJHL
SULLIVAN COUNTY, Tenn. (WJHL) — A man accused of murdering a Kingsport woman in 2019 accepted a guilty plea deal this month, Sullivan County's Assistant District Attorney Kristen Rose confirmed. Nathaniel White-Young was initially charged with first-degree murder after Melissa Mingle, 37, was found unresponsive in her front yard on Fordtown Road on Oct. 6, 2019. Mingle died days later.
